from unittest import mock
from webob import exc
from oslo_serialization import jsonutils
from senlin.api.common import util
from senlin.api.middleware import fault
from senlin.api.openstack.v1 import receivers
from senlin.common import exception as senlin_exc
from senlin.common import policy
from senlin.rpc import client as rpc_client
from senlin.tests.unit.api import shared
from senlin.tests.unit.common import base
@mock.patch.object(policy, 'enforce')
class ReceiverControllerTest(shared.ControllerTest, base.SenlinTestCase):
def setUp(self):
super(ReceiverControllerTest, self).setUp()
class DummyConfig(object):
bind_port = 8777
cfgopts = DummyConfig()
self.controller = receivers.ReceiverController(options=cfgopts)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_normal(self, mock_call, mock_parse,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
req = self._get('/receivers')
engine_resp = [
{
u'id': u'aaaa-bbbb-cccc',
u'name': u'test-receiver',
u'type': u'webhook',
u'user': u'admin',
u'project': u'123456abcd3555',
u'domain': u'default',
u'cluster_id': u'FAKE_CLUSTER',
u'action': u'test-action',
u'actor': {
u'user_id': u'test-user-id',
u'password': u'test-pass',
},
u'created_time': u'2015-02-24T19:17:22Z',
u'params': {},
'channel': {
'alarm_url': 'http://somewhere/on/earth',
},
}
]
mock_call.return_value = engine_resp
obj = mock.Mock()
mock_parse.return_value = obj
result = self.controller.index(req)
self.assertEqual(engine_resp, result['receivers'])
mock_parse.assert_called_once_with(
'ReceiverListRequest', req, mock.ANY)
mock_call.assert_called_with(req.context, 'receiver_list', obj)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_whitelists_params(self, mock_call,
mock_parse,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
marker = 'cac6d9c1-cb4e-4884-ba2a-3cbc72d84aaf'
params = {
'limit': 20,
'marker': marker,
'sort': 'name:desc',
'name': 'receiver01',
'type': 'webhook',
'cluster_id': '123abc',
'action': 'CLUSTER_RESIZE',
'user': 'user123'
}
req = self._get('/receivers', params=params)
mock_call.return_value = []
obj = mock.Mock()
mock_parse.return_value = obj
result = self.controller.index(req)
self.assertEqual([], result['receivers'])
mock_parse.assert_called_once_with(
'ReceiverListRequest', req,
{
'sort': 'name:desc',
'name': ['receiver01'],
'action': ['CLUSTER_RESIZE'],
'limit': '20',
'marker': marker,
'cluster_id': ['123abc'],
'type': ['webhook'],
'project_safe': True,
'user': ['user123']
})
mock_call.assert_called_with(req.context, 'receiver_list', mock.ANY)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_whitelists_invalid_params(self, mock_call,
mock_parse,
m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
params = {
'balrog': 'you shall not pass!'
}
req = self._get('/receivers', params=params)
ex = self.assertRaises(exc.HTTPBadRequest,
self.controller.index, req)
self.assertEqual("Invalid parameter balrog", str(ex))
self.assertFalse(mock_parse.called)
self.assertFalse(mock_call.called)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_invalid_type(self, mock_call,
mock_parse,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
params = {'type': 'bogus'}
req = self._get('/receivers', params=params)
mock_parse.side_effect = exc.HTTPBadRequest("bad param")
ex = self.assertRaises(exc.HTTPBadRequest,
self.controller.index, req)
self.assertEqual("bad param", str(ex))
mock_parse.assert_called_once_with(
'ReceiverListRequest', req,
{
'type': ['bogus'],
'project_safe': True
})
self.assertFalse(mock_call.called)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_invalid_action(self, mock_call,
mock_parse,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
params = {'action': 'bogus'}
req = self._get('/receivers', params=params)
mock_parse.side_effect = exc.HTTPBadRequest("bad param")
ex = self.assertRaises(exc.HTTPBadRequest,
self.controller.index, req)
self.assertEqual("bad param", str(ex))
mock_parse.assert_called_once_with(
'ReceiverListRequest', req,
{
'action': ['bogus'],
'project_safe': True
})
self.assertFalse(mock_call.called)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_limit_non_int(self, mock_call,
mock_parse,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
params = {'limit': 'abc'}
req = self._get('/receivers', params=params)
mock_parse.side_effect = exc.HTTPBadRequest("bad param")
ex = self.assertRaises(exc.HTTPBadRequest,
self.controller.index, req)
self.assertEqual("bad param", str(ex))
mock_parse.assert_called_once_with(
'ReceiverListRequest', req,
{
'limit': 'abc',
'project_safe': True
})
self.assertFalse(mock_call.called)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_invalid_sort(self, mock_call,
mock_parse,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
params = {'sort': 'bogus:foo'}
req = self._get('/receivers', params=params)
mock_parse.side_effect = exc.HTTPBadRequest("bad param")
ex = self.assertRaises(exc.HTTPBadRequest,
self.controller.index, req)
self.assertEqual("bad param", str(ex))
mock_parse.assert_called_once_with(
'ReceiverListRequest', req,
{
'sort': 'bogus:foo',
'project_safe': True
})
self.assertFalse(mock_call.called)
@mock.patch.object(util, 'parse_request')
@mock.patch.object(rpc_client.EngineClient, 'call')
def test_receiver_index_global_project(self, mock_call,
mock_parse,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', True)
params = {'global_project': True}
req = self._get('/receivers', params=params)
mock_call.return_value = []
obj = mock.Mock()
mock_parse.return_value = obj
result = self.controller.index(req)
self.assertEqual([], result['receivers'])
mock_parse.assert_called_once_with(
'ReceiverListRequest', req, {'project_safe': False})
mock_call.assert_called_once_with(
req.context, 'receiver_list', obj)
def test_receiver_index_denied_policy(self, mock_enforce):
self._mock_enforce_setup(mock_enforce, 'index', False)
req = self._get('/receivers')
resp = shared.request_with_middleware(fault.FaultWrapper,
self.controller.index, req)
self.assertEqual(403, resp.status_int)
self.assertIn('403 Forbidden', str(resp))
